lvs负载均衡+keepalived主备高可用+ELK日志文件图形化管理 部署案例


案例环境示意图

在这里插入图片描述
根据客户要求 需要为web服务器配置负载均衡和高可用 并使用ELK分析和可视化管理日志

配置web1和web2服务器

Yum安装httpd在var/www/html/下创建index.html分别写入this is web1和web2
且配置lvs负载均衡脚本
在这里插入图片描述
在这里插入图片描述

sh dr.sh

启动调用脚本

配置lva+keepalived

在主备服务器上配置lvs负载均衡+keepalived主备切换高可用
在这里插入图片描述

在这里插入图片描述
在这里插入图片描述
编译安装keepalived
在这里插入图片描述
修改keepalived配置文件 指定端口 主备服务器 服务器名 组号 优先级 验证类型 密码和漂移地址
在这里插入图片描述
在这里插入图片描述
启动服务
配置备keepalived服务器
安装依赖环境 编译安装keepalived
更改keepalived配置文件指定
在这里插入图片描述
测试负载均衡轮询
在这里插入图片描述
在这里插入图片描述
查看访问记录
在这里插入图片描述
测试地址漂移
在这里插入图片描述
在keepalived备用上查看日志文件 显示主备切换

在这里插入图片描述

再次启动主keepalived 主备还原
在这里插入图片描述

配置es日志文件管理集群

在这里插入图片描述

在这里插入图片描述
安装图形化模块
在这里插入图片描述
在这里插入图片描述

设置群集名 群集号 数据库位置和日志文件位置 监听地址和端口 群集地址

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

第二台es同理 修改群组号 和 集群地址即可
启动服务器

在这里插入图片描述
在这里插入图片描述

测试登录本地web访问es
在这里插入图片描述
确认集群成功

配置logstash

  • 收集web服务器access日志发送给es
    Yum安装logstash 测试服务 配置传输配置文件将接收地址指定为es主服务器
    在这里插入图片描述
    传输日志 配置文件
    在这里插入图片描述
    Web2上同理 传输日志文件
    在es上查看是否成功

在这里插入图片描述

配置kibana

在kibana服务器上安装kibana
修改kibana配置文件 指定端口 es地址
在这里插入图片描述
在这里插入图片描述
开启监听 另起终端
使用浏览器查看kibana

在这里插入图片描述

  • 0
    点赞
  • 3
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值